FrameworX 10.1 Update 5d — planned for August 5, 2026
AI, MCP and automation
- Author display configuration completely from automation — legend, connections, chart orientation, child-display links, and themes.
- Update a display’s code-behind script without altering the drawing canvas — content-only display import.
- Importing a display page from JSON preserves all content — nested groups, dialog settings, and exact layout.
- Writing a display from automation replaces its elements instead of duplicating them when the display’s editor is open.
- Reading several displays in one full-detail request returns results instead of reporting the one-at-a-time limit.
- Verify dialog content and prompts in automated Designer tests, without rendering them.
- Drive and complete suppressed Designer configuration dialogs in automated tests, without rendering them.
- Drive and observe the running operator clients — both WPF and web — from automated tests.
- Validate electronic-signature and security workflows with automated tests, safely.

- Concurrent AI sessions no longer overwrite each other’s exported solution files.
- Security secrets written through the AI tools are stored encrypted, and password fields are protected on every tool surface.
- Designer instances started by the AI tools are reused and shut down cleanly instead of accumulating.
- Solution exports record the full path the solution was created at, not just its name.
- Recursive (self-referencing) template definitions are blocked when authored programmatically, with a warning at build time.
- MCP server hardening batch — a set of robustness and safety corrections across the MCP server surface.
Local AI and AI Chat
- Local AI endpoint configuration is easier to get right — whitespace is trimmed and sensible defaults (URL, headers, secret name) are pre-seeded when a provider preset is selected.
- Updated Claude model suggestions and clearer AI endpoint Test results.
- AI Chat: the Context grounding field can no longer be pointed at the question or reply tag, which previously produced self-referential grounding.
Displays and Symbols
- Symbol size no longer reverts to default when importing a display from JSON.
- Symbol rotation no longer reverts to 0° when importing a display from JSON.
- Symbol legend is imported when importing a Display page.
- Option to hide the border of a symbol’s legend.
- Library symbols with a theme-color FillColor dynamic render correctly in the Designer editor — runtime rendering was already correct.
- Fill color is applied to the intended object when another object is clicked immediately after.
- Canceling a drawing tool mid-draw leaves no leftover connections, orphan shapes, or phantom undo entries.
- Selecting a button whose Action script method was renamed or deleted no longer silently clears its Action target.
- Editing a button’s Action settings enables the Save button in Designer.
- Display Connectors infrastructure re-enabled.
- Folder-path tag bindings compile correctly in Canvas display code-behind.
- Trend Chart: tags with Quality 64 no longer interpolate between two Quality 192 points.
HTML5 and web client
- The HTML5 web client loads significantly faster with compressed delivery and browser caching.
- TDataGrid columns no longer appear blank when FieldName casing does not exactly match the DataTable column name.
- Web Display scripts no longer fail when a referenced Script Class had not yet been built for the web.

Unified Namespace, Tags and Ontology
- Importing an ontology (RDF/OWL) creates the object relationships and the asset-tree hierarchy.
- The ISA-88 ontology import template’s mapping rules are applied instead of being silently ignored.
- Exporting and re-importing a UNS graph preserves the asset hierarchy when entities carry a source IRI.
- Importing tags and displays together resolves display bindings to the new tags.
- The Asset Tree tab shows folders and tags in order after importing an existing solution’s UNS.
- Initial values for GUID tags are retained when set through the Asset Tree view or at tag creation.
- Tag rename in the asset tree works when only letter case changes.
- EngWrapper API — set a tag’s per-instance property overrides (StartValue, Min, Max, Disable, DisplayText, Description, Enumeration) on UserType member instances.
Devices and protocols
- PEER Protocol Driver — new communication driver.
- Store-and-forward (local buffering) for the Azure IoT Hub / MQTT driver.
- Modbus TCP master sends well-formed frames and reads devices correctly.

Alarms, Historian and redundancy
- Historian and Alarm redundancy replication keeps up on large projects — the standby database synchronizes fully.
- Alarm Viewer respects the custom alarm-history table name, and single alarms save correctly on SQL Server historians.
- Diagnostic tools can connect to the standby server in redundant systems.
- The standby server no longer starts the Devices module Running when a device has Initial State Reserved or Remote.
Designer, Solution Center and packaging
- Designer no longer freezes for several seconds when opening Solution Capabilities for the first time.
- Solution Center licensing calls are more resilient — connection reuse, recovery after network loss, and forward-slash path handling.
- MCP configuration inconsistencies in templates corrected, along with a truncated label in Execution Profiles.
Lifecycle and Support
Update 5d is planned as a free upgrade for every FrameworX 10.x customer, shipping with the platform’s standard within-major-version 100% compatibility commitment.
